If you can self-host it, then you can look at either Monitorr or Uptime-Kuma. Both have webpages you can configure, and at least Uptime-Kuma has notification capability with a number of options for how you receive those notifications. From what I remember neither will inform you of available updates, I use Diun or Watchtower for that.
